There is a benefit on the e36/e46 since you can replace the upper control arm with an adjustable link and save 5 lbs.
And you can get more travel in the spring. I think it's mostly pointless on the E9X.

redpriest with my kit, JRZ's manual recommends 5 clicks for street, 10 clicks for track. There's a total of 24 clicks possible. Does that line up with your RS Pro? If so, maybe it's similar!
gmx we were initially thinking of corner balancing but forgot to in the middle of the big overhaul on my car, will probably do it next time! Car is pretty much a stock ZCP weight wise, no major weight reduction done. With 550 front / 800 rear it feels well sorted on street. Will need to find out on track! |
